What is a solar tracking system?

A solar panel precisely perpendicular to the sun produces more power than one not aligned. The main application of solar tracking system is to position solar photovoltaic (PV) panels towards the Sun. Most commonly they are used with mirrors to redirect sunlight on the panels.

Working of A Solar TrackerTypes of A Solar TrackerWhat Are The Pros of A Solar Tracker?What Are The Cons of A Solar Tracker?Is A Solar Tracking System Right For You?ConclusionFAQsA solar tracker positions the solar panels at an angle directed to the sun. It is an advanced sun monitoring system that can rotate the panels to track the movement of the sun across the sky.
